Anchor – Ruth Meiners, 97 of Tucson, AZ, formerly of Anchor, passed away February 7, 2011 at her residence in Tucson.
Funeral will be held at 11:00am, Monday, February 14, 2011 at St. John's Lutheran Church, Anchor with visitation one hour prior. The Reverend Stephen Goodwin will be officiating. Burial will be in St. John's Lutheran Church Cemetery, Anchor.
Visitation will be held 2-4:00pm, Sunday, February 13, 2011 at Duffy-Pils Memorial Home, Colfax.
Memorials may be made to St. John's Lutheran Church.
Ruth was born September 23, 1913 in Fairbury, IL the daughter of Henry and Charlotte Jacobs Harms. She married Peter John Meiners on December 21, 1941 in Anchor. He died July 17, 1992.
Surviving are her children, Robert (Faith) Falkner of Paradise Valley, AZ, Phyllis Youngberg of Fort Worth, TX, Robert (Sherilyn) Meiners of Anchor, Glen (Annyce) Meiners of Tucson, AZ, John (Jean) Meiners of Anchor, Richard (Ann) Meiners of Tucson, AZ; sisters, Mildred (Rufus) Meinhold Hays of Overland Park and Joanne Otto Rettke of Bloomington; brother, Stanley Harms of Bloomington; sister-in-law, Rose Orrendorf; 10 grandchildren and 11 great-grandchildren.
She was preceded in death by her parents, one brother, Floyd Harms, two sisters, Doris Ann and Lois Gleeson.
Ruth was a lifelong farmer with her husband on their Illinois Centennial Farm in the Anchor area.
She was a member of St. John's Lutheran Church, Anchor.
Ruth was an avid gardener, seamstress and enjoyed her fabric shopping trips with Doris Bielfeldt, and was unanimously voted by her family as a "Famous Cook".
She was a woman who was devoted to her children, grandchildren, nieces and nephews; to Ruth family was everything.
